Wells Fargo Moving Ahead With Foreclosures

by The Chris Baynes Team

After a brief moratorium, Wells Fargo has announced it will refile over 55,000 foreclosures.  Several large lenders have been accused of mishandling foreclosures and had put a temporary stop on them to review thier processes.  Wells Fargo claims there were only technical errors and did nat affect the validity of the foreclosures and are now moving forward.

This will be of concern to anyone who is potentially faced with foreclosures if thier loan is with Wells Fargo.  Many had hoped that the halt of foreclsoures would encourage the lenders to modify loans or approve a higher amount of short sales.  Foreclosures and short sales in Wilmington NC are available for viewing on this web site.

Be All They Can Be?

by The Chris Baynes Team
Monday Morning Coffee

INSPIRATION FOR TODAY:

"Whatever you can do, or dream you can, begin it.
Boldness has genius, power, and magic in it."
- Goethe


BE ALL THAT THEY CAN BE?

On an A&E Biography segment, Oprah Winfrey was being interviewed. She was asked whether she considered all the competing talk shows to be a threat to her own daytime show. She answered with a personal story about running in a marathon.

It seems Oprah had always had a dream of running in a marathon. She trained for two years to get ready, and she ran her marathon. Oprah explained that, to her, competition was like that marathon. As long as she was hitting her stride with her goal of winning in clear focus, there was no time to consider the competition. She added that just turning her head backward to see how close competing runners were to her position was enough to rob her of energy needed to win the race.

Oprah's view of the competition brought to mind the U.S. Army recruiting slogan: "Be all that you can be!" Note that it doesn't say, "Be all that THEY can be!" Even when your competition has a recognizable face, why would you want to be them? If you want to improve yourself, speed up your achievements, or earn more money, why not just better your own time? Comparing yourself to others is a waste of precious time and energy.

Realizing your dreams requires a roadmap. First, you decide on a destination - your dream. Next, you choose a route. For Oprah, that involved hiring a personal trainer, improving her aerobic capacity, and adding strength training to her daily regimen. It also helps to identify some stops or landmarks along the way to help you measure your progress. Finally, you apply all your energy to running the race - and achieving your dream.

Oprah's dream was to run a marathon. What's yours?

Redefining Yourself

by The Chris Baynes Team
Monday Morning Coffee

INSPIRATION FOR TODAY:

"Pursue the good ardently. But if your efforts fall short, accept the result and move on."
- Epictetus


WHO ARE YOU?

Who do you want to be? Which are the principles by which you want to live? Do honesty, perseverance, and wisdom define you? Are sincerity, generosity, and a caring attitude your trademark?

Having a vague idea of the benchmark traits you wish to exhibit is not enough. To be extraordinary, it is necessary to define yourself in specific terms. If you haven't adopted a precise set of principles, consider choosing from the list that follows: humility, diligence, moderation, silence, temperance, chastity, courage, resolution, justice, industry, faithfulness, order, tranquility, cleanliness, encouragement, frugality, generosity, sincerity, persistence, honesty, perseverance, or caring.

Choose five that most closely match the person you would choose to be. Next define what each means to you, and how you can adopt them as your trademark traits. Finally, begin acting like the person you would be. Ben Franklin kept a small diary and rated his actions each day by placing a checkmark each time he violated one of his personal principles. Over time, as the checkmarks dwindled for one principle, he would move on to the next.

There's no need to discuss your quest for a principle-centered life with anyone. This is personal, very personal. It's also important to accept the fact that once you've adopted a credo, you won't do a perfect job of living up to it. When you find you've fallen short, "accept the result and move on."

Unless you're living the perfect life right now, and most of us aren't, give some thought to redefining yourself. Decide to be extraordinary and do whatever you must do - NOW!

New FHA Rules In October 2010

by The Chris Baynes Team

New FHA rules are going into effect on October 4, 2010. In an effort to reduce risk to FHA and increase its strength, these rules will also cause some buyers to lose the ability to purchase a home with an FHA loan.

Bryan Wright with Advantage Loans in Fayetteville, NC has this to say:

"I wanted to let you know the changes that are set to take place October 4, 2010 in regards to FHA.

The upfront Mortgage Insurance Premium will be reduced to 1%.  If you recall this was increased in April, 2010 to 2.25%.  However, before you become too excited – the monthly mortgage insurance amount is being increased from .55% to 1.55%.  This is for FHA loans with a loan-to-value greater than 95%.

Why are they doing this?   The new law, signed by the President on August 12th of this year, permits HUD to increase the amount of mortgage insurance premiums on FHA Insured mortgages. HUD has decided to raise the annual premium and correspondingly lower the upfront premium so that FHA is in a better position to address the increase demands of the marketplace and return the Mutual Mortgage Insurance (MMI) fund to congressionally mandated levels without disruption to the housing market.  This change is effective October 4, 2010 for FHA loans for which the case number is assigned on or after October 4, 2010. (Case numbers are assigned when the appraisal is ordered)."

 

FHA loans have become more popular than ever with home buyers that do not have or want to pay a 20% down payment. Other options are VA 100% loan and the ever popular 100% USDA loans available in surprisingly large numbers.
